Guys already asked but got no response. Is it possible to run leonArdo in headless mode on a Debian/Ubuntu server?
The Margin Software Team is taking a Christmas break after working so hard to push out the latest version, but I can answer that question. No, there is not currently a headless version. I operate mine via Remmina VNC through an SSH tunnel with XFCE4 for the desktop and vnc4server running on the server, all native Ubuntu software. I have been able to achieve continuous run times as long as 11 days 13 hours, then Bittrex threw so many invalid API responses that leonArdo crashed.
